When you join the OLED Manufacturing Technician team you will be part of the core group who handles set-up, operation, maintenance and troubleshooting of machines and equipment used in manufacturing, R&D, pilot, test and production materials at both intermediate and finished good levels. You will monitor quality, test devices, collect and analyze data and more! You can’t mind being on your feet as you will be working on our machines and tools in a busy environment.
WhatYou’ll Do Every Day
- Operate equipment and test materials and products to raise product quality and profitability.
- Establish new or modified equipment run parameters and assist with equipment installation and validation.
- Contribute to continuous improvement of processes and procedures.
- Collaborate closely with a team of engineers and scientists and may contribute to special projects.
- Comply with safety regulations and maintain clean work areas.
- Document statistical process control, record results, and write procedures, including work performed at the desk in addition to hands-on work in Fab or Lab.
- Contribute to the Quality Management System in Rochester and help OLEDWorks maintain ISO 9001 and IATF certifications.
